    <![CDATA[<strong>Author:</strong> <a href="http://www.rpod-owners.com/member_profile.asp?PF=6872" rel="nofollow">Sierra Jim</a><br /><strong>Subject:</strong> 11033<br /><strong>Posted:</strong> 02 Jan 2018 at 6:00pm<br /><br />Was using my 2017 r-pod 179 as an extra bedroom over the holidays using a 30 AMP female to a 15 AMP RV Cord Adapter. The electric seemed to work fine, but I could not set the thermostat on my heater above 32 degrees. The temperature was actually quite comfortable with the thermostat at 20 degrees. Although I had removed the batteries for winter storage, I don't understand why I could not set the thermostat above 32 degrees?]]>
